MODULE_VERSION(9)	 BSD Kernel Developer's Manual	     MODULE_VERSION(9)

NAME
     MODULE_VERSION — set kernel module version

SYNOPSIS
     #include <sys/param.h>
     #include <sys/module.h>

     MODULE_VERSION(name, int version);

DESCRIPTION
     The MODULE_VERSION() macro sets the version of the module called name.
     Other kernel modules can then depend on this module (see
     MODULE_DEPEND(9)).

EXAMPLES
     MODULE_VERSION(foo, 1);

SEE ALSO
     DECLARE_MODULE(9), module(9), MODULE_DEPEND(9)
